When was EXPRESS FUELS (SCOTLAND) LIMITED founded?
EXPRESS FUELS (SCOTLAND) LIMITED was officially incorporated on 19 July 1993 and is registered under company number SC145520. Incorporation establishes the company as a legal entity registered at Companies House, allowing it to trade, enter contracts, and operate under UK company law.

What does EXPRESS FUELS (SCOTLAND) LIMITED do?
EXPRESS FUELS (SCOTLAND) LIMITED operates in the following sector: 47990 - Other retail sale not in stores, stalls or markets. This provides insight into the company's primary business activity and industry focus.

Is EXPRESS FUELS (SCOTLAND) LIMITED financially stable?
The most recent accounts for EXPRESS FUELS (SCOTLAND) LIMITED were made up to 31 March 2024, filed as MICRO ENTITY. Next accounts are due by 31 March 2026.
Does EXPRESS FUELS (SCOTLAND) LIMITED have any charges or mortgages?
EXPRESS FUELS (SCOTLAND) LIMITED has 1 registered charge, of which 1 is outstanding, 0 satisfied, and 0 part satisfied. Charges are typically registered when a company uses its assets as security for borrowing.
